RAILWAY VEHICLE BRAKE PRESSURE CONTROL DEVICE, AND CONTROL METHOD THEREFOR

The present invention relates to an apparatus for controlling a brake pressure of a railway vehicle, including: a microcomputer controller and a brake pressure regulation mechanism, where the brake pressure regulation mechanism includes a deflation valve, a holding valve, and a pressure sensor configured to feed back a brake pressure to the microcomputer controller; and a holding solenoid valve and a deflation solenoid valve that are controlled by the microcomputer controller, where a main air supply is connected to air inlets of the holding solenoid valve, the deflation solenoid valve, and the holding valve respectively, an air outlet of the holding solenoid valve is connected to first pressure ports of the deflation valve and the holding valve, an air outlet of the deflation solenoid valve is connected to second pressure ports of the deflation valve and the holding valve, a deflation port of the deflation valve is in communication with the atmosphere, and pressure output ports of the deflation valve and the holding valve are connected to a brake pipe. The deflation valve and the holding valve are driven through the holding solenoid valve and the deflation solenoid valve, to perform inflation, deflation, and pressure holding for the brake pressure, and implement closed-loop control. The present invention has the features of high control accuracy, a rapid response, and being free from impact of performance changes or degradation of valves.
